Can imagined whole-body rotations improve vestibular compensation?
Christophe Lopez1, Dominique Vibert, Fred W Mast
1Department of Psychology, University of Bern, Bern, Switzerland. christophe.lopez@psy.unibe.ch
Mental imagery of whole-body rotations may rebalance vestibular nuclei activity, aiding recovery from unilateral vestibular loss. This approach could reduce falls and postural instability in patients, offering a safe, home-based therapy.
Area of Science:
- Neuroscience
- Vestibular System Research
- Rehabilitation Medicine
Background:
- Unilateral vestibular damage causes vertigo, imbalance, and disorientation due to imbalanced neural activity.
- Vestibular compensation, a natural recovery process, is often hindered by patient-driven avoidance of movement.
- Cortical control over vestibular nuclei suggests top-down manipulation is possible.
Purpose of the Study:
- To propose mental imagery of whole-body rotations as a novel method to enhance vestibular compensation.
- To investigate if imagined movements can rebalance neural activity in vestibular nuclei.
- To explore a potential therapeutic strategy for reducing postural instability and falls.
Main Methods:
- Review of neuroanatomical and neuroimaging evidence on cortical control of vestibular nuclei.
- Hypothesizing the use of mental imagery of rotations to the lesioned and healthy sides.
- Proposing a randomized controlled study to test the efficacy of mental imagery training.
Main Results:
- Evidence suggests imagined movements activate the vestibular cortex.
- Hypothesized mechanism: rebalancing ipsilesional and contralesional vestibular nuclei activity.
- Potential for improved vestibular compensation and reduced symptoms.
Conclusions:
- Mental imagery of whole-body rotations is a promising, non-invasive approach for vestibular rehabilitation.
- This method could overcome limitations of physical therapy by avoiding nausea-inducing movements.
- It offers a simple, safe, self-administered therapy for vestibular disorders.
